Меню

Пример фильтр содержания mdaemon настройка

Пример фильтр содержания mdaemon настройка

Переход: Учетные записи > Менеджер учетных записей > Редактор учетных записей >

В пакете MDaemon пользователи IMAP и WorldClient могут с помощью фильтров автоматически направлять свою почту в указанные папки на сервере. Как и в фильтрах содержания, MDaemon проверяет заголовок каждого сообщения для этой учетной записи, а затем сравнивает его с заданными фильтрами. Если сообщение для учетной записи соответствует одному из фильтров, MDaemon поместит его в папку, заданную в этом фильтре. Этот метод намного эффективнее (как для клиента, так и для сервера), чем фильтрация сообщений на стороне клиента, и, поскольку некоторые почтовые клиенты вообще не поддерживают локальные правила и фильтрацию сообщений, почтовые фильтры предоставляют им такую функциональность.

Администраторы могут задавать Фильтры IMAP в «Редакторе учетных записей», либо с помощью WebAdmin. В то же время, вы можете дать своим пользователям возможность самостоятельно создавать и контролировать свои фильтры в модулях WorldClient и WebAdmin. Эти разрешения устанавливаются в диалоге WorldClient и WebAdmin.

Правила фильтра IMAP

В этом поле отображается список всех фильтров, которые были созданы для этой учетной записи пользователя. Фильтры применяются в том порядке, в котором они перечислены, до тех пор, пока не обнаружится совпадение. Следовательно, как только будет обнаружено соответствие одному из фильтров, сообщение будет перемещено в папку, указанную в этом фильтре, и обработка фильтров для этого сообщения прекратится. Используйте кнопки « Вверх » и « Вниз » для перемещения фильтров по списку.

Нажатием этой кнопки вы удалите все фильтры этого пользователя.

Выберите фильтр из списка, затем нажмите эту кнопку для его перемещения вверх.

Выберите фильтр из списка, затем нажмите эту кнопку для его перемещения вниз.

Если. [заголовок/размер сообщения]

Выберите « Размер сообщения » или заголовок из выпадающего списка, или введите нужное название заголовка в поле, если его нет в списке. После определения заголовка MDaemon будет проверять все входящие сообщения учетной записи на наличие текста, указанного в поле « данное значение ». Затем, на основе проведённого сравнения, будет определено, какие сообщения должны быть перемещены в папку, указанную для данного фильтра.

В этом списке перечислены типы сравнения, которые используются при сравнении заголовка сообщения с фильтром. MDaemon сравнит текст заголовка, с текстом указанным в поле « данное значение » (или сравнивать размер сообщения со значением, указанным в этом поле), выдаст результат сравнения в зависимости от настройки этой опции — полное совпадение текста или размера, неполное совпадение, вхождение текста, полное отсутствие текста, начало с текстом и т.д.

Введите текст, поиск которого будет проводить MDaemon при проверке заголовка, указанного для этого фильтра. Когда в фильтре задана проверка размера сообщения, в этом поле указывается размер сообщения в килобайтах.

. переместить сообщение в эту папку

Нажмите эту кнопку для создания новой папки. Вы увидите диалог «Создать папку», где вам нужно будет указать имя папки. Если вы хотите, чтобы это была подпапка существующей папки, выберите эту папку из выпадающего списка.

Когда вы закончите настройку параметров нового фильтра, нажмите эту кнопку, чтобы добавить его в список.

Субадресация – это система, которая использует включение названия папки в часть с названием почтового ящика адреса некоторой учетной записи электронной почты. Используя эту систему, письма с адресом в виде комбинации почтовый ящик+имя папки будут автоматически перенаправлены в папку почтового ящика, указанную в этом адресе (предполагается, что такая папка уже существует), при этом для выполнения таких действий не нужно создавать никакие особые правила фильтрации.

Например, если в учетной записи frank.thomas@example.com есть почтовая папка IMAP под названием “ stuff ”, то почта, приходящая на адрес “ frank.thomas+stuff@example.com ”, будет автоматически помещаться в эту папку. Подпапки можно назначить путем объединения имен папки и подпапки через знак «+», пробелы в названиях папок заменяются символом подчеркивания. Возвращаясь к вышеуказанному примеру, если в папке “ stuff ” есть подпапка с названием “ my older stuff ”, то сообщения с адресом “ frank.thomas+stuff.my_older_stuff@example.com ” будут автоматически перенаправлены в почтовую папку “ stuff\my older stuff ” пользователя Frank Thomas.

Чтобы предотвратить попытки взлома и несанкционированного использования, включенная в субадрес папка IMAP должна существовать. Если сообщение с субадресом получает учетная запись, у которой нет почтовой подпапки с названием, указанным в субадресе, тогда этот субадрес будет рассматриваться и обрабатываться, как неизвестный адрес эл. почты, исходя из других настроек MDaemon. Например, если у учетной записи frank@example.com нет подпапки под названием “ stuff ”, а сообщение прибывает на адрес “ frank+stuff@example.com ”, это сообщение будет обрабатываться, как будто оно было адресовано неизвестному пользователю и скорее всего будет отклонено.

Читайте также:  Как разобраться в настройках зеркального фотоаппарата

Включите эту опцию, если хотите разрешить использование субадресации для этой учетной записи.

По умолчанию субадресация отключена отдельно для каждой учетной записи. Тем не менее, вы можете отключить эту функцию глобально с помощью опции « Отключить субадресацию для всех уч. записей », размещенной на вкладке «Различные опции» в диалоге «Настройки». Если субадресация отключена с помощью этой глобальной опции, тогда ее нельзя будет включить ни для какой учетной записи, независимо от индивидуальных настроек учетных записей.

Источник

Правила

Все сообщения, обработанные MDaemon, будут в некоторые моменты временно располагаться в одной из очередей сообщений. Если Фильтр Содержания включен, то перед тем, как любое из сообщений сможет покинуть очередь, сначала оно должно будет пройти проверку по правилам фильтрации сообщений. Результат этой процедуры и определит, что делать с этим сообщением дальше.

Если сообщение записано в файле с именем, начинающимся с латинской буквы «P», такое сообщение будет проигнорировано в процессе фильтрации содержимого. Все остальные сообщения пройдут обработку в системе фильтрации содержания. Как только сообщение будет обработано, MDaemon изменит первую букву в названии его файла на «P». Таким образом, система фильтрации содержимого будет обрабатывать любое из сообщений не более одного раза.

Правила фильтрации содержания

Включить механизм обработки правил

Поставьте флажок в этом поле для включения фильтрации содержания. Все сообщения, обрабатываемые MDaemon, перед доставкой будут проходить через правила фильтрации содержания.

Существующие правила фильтрации содержания

В этом поле перечислены все ваши правила фильтрации содержания, а поле рядом с каждым правилом позволяет вам включать/отключать их по своему усмотрению. Чтобы посмотреть описание любого из правил в специальном внутреннем формате описания скриптов, щелкните и задержите указатель мыши на нужном правиле (если сдвинуть мышь, описание правила закроется). Каждый раз, когда через фильтр содержания проходит какое-либо письмо, эти правила применяются в том порядке, в котором они перечислены. Это позволяет вам задавать порядок правил для достижения более высокого уровня универсальности.

Например: если у вас есть правило, которое удаляет все сообщения, содержащие слова «Это спам!», и еще одно подобное правило, которое отправляет такие сообщения постмастеру, то, расположив их в правильном порядке, вы обеспечите применение к сообщению обоих этих правил. Это подразумевает, что здесь нет правила «Остановка обработки правил», которое применяется к сообщению выше по списку. Если такое правило есть, вам придется использовать кнопки » Переместить вверх / Переместить вниз «, чтобы перенести правило «Остановки» ниже двух других. После этого любое сообщение с текстом «Это спам!» будет копироваться постмастеру, а затем удаляться.

Нажмите эту кнопку для создания нового правила фильтрации содержания. При этом откроется диалог «Создать правило».

Нажмите эту кнопку, чтобы открыть правило в редакторе «Изменить правило».

Нажмите эту кнопку для создания копии выделенного правила фильтрации содержания. Будет создано такое же правило, и оно будет добавлено в список. Новому правилу по умолчанию дается название «Copy of [Имя исходного правила]». Это полезно, если вы хотите создать несколько похожих правил. Вы можете создать одно правило, скопировать его несколько раз, а затем изменить эти копии по своему усмотрению.

Нажмите эту кнопку для удаления выделенного правила фильтрации содержания. Вам нужно будет подтвердить свое решение об удалении правила, прежде чем MDaemon сделает это.

Нажмите эту кнопку для перемещения выбранного правила вверх.

Нажмите эту кнопку для перемещения выбранного правила вниз по списку.

Источник

Создание нового правила фильтрации содержания

Этот диалог используется для создания новых правил фильтрации содержания. Он открывается при нажатии кнопки » Новое правило » в диалоге «Фильтр Содержания».

Назовите это правило

Укажите здесь описывающее имя для вашего нового правила. По умолчанию оно будет называться «New Rule #n».

В этом поле перечислены условия, которые могут быть применены в вашем новом правиле. Поставьте флажок в поле, соответствующем любому из условий, которое вы хотите применить в новом правиле. Каждое активное условие будет отображено в поле «Описания правила» внизу диалога. Для большинства условий нужна дополнительная информация, которую вы зададите, щелкнув на ссылке нужного Условия в поле «Описание правила».

If the [HEADER] contains — Включите какую-либо из этих опций для проверки этим правилом содержимого выбранных заголовков сообщений. Вы должны задать текст, который нужно искать. В этом условии теперь поддерживаются регулярные выражения. См. также:Использование регулярных выражений в правилах фильтрации.

If the user defined [# HEADER] contains — Включите одну или несколько из этих опций для проверки этим правилом заголовков сообщений, которые вы определите сами. Вам нужно задать этот новый заголовок и текст, который нужно искать. В этом условии теперь поддерживаются регулярные выражения. См. также:Использование регулярных выражений в правилах фильтрации.

Читайте также:  Настройка карбюратора в марьино

If the MESSAGE BODY contains — Эта опция делает содержимое тела сообщения одним из элементов проверяемого условия. Для этого условия вы должны указать текстовую строку, которую нужно искать. В этом условии теперь поддерживаются регулярные выражения. См. также:Использование регулярных выражений в правилах фильтрации.

If the MESSAGE has Attachment(s) — Если включена эта опция, правило будет задействовано только при наличии в сообщении одного или нескольких вложений. Никаких дополнительных сведений указывать не нужно.

If the MESSAGE HAS A FILE called — При включении этой опции будет выполняться поиск вложенного файла с конкретным именем. Следует обязательно указывать имя файла. Разрешены символы подстановки, такие как «*.exe» и «file*.*».

If the EXIT CODE from a previous run process is equal to — Если предыдущее правило в вашем списке использует действие » Run process «, то вы можете применить это условие для поиска определенного кода выхода, сгенерированного этим процессом.

If the MESSAGE IS DIGITALLY SIGNED — Условие применяется к сообщениям, снабженным цифровой подписью. Никаких дополнительных сведений для этого условия указывать не нужно.

If SENDER is a member of GROUP. — Это условие применяется к сообщениям, когда их отправляет учетная запись, которая входит в группу учетных записей (Group), заданную в этом правиле.

If RECIPIENT is a member of GROUP. — Это условие применяется к сообщениям, когда их адресатом является учетная запись, которая входит в группу учетных записей (Group), заданную в данном правиле.

If ALL MESSAGES — Включите эту опцию, если хотите, чтобы правило применялось ко всем сообщениям. Никаких дополнительных сведений указывать не нужно; это правило будет действовать на каждое сообщение, кроме тех, для которых в предыдущем правиле применено действие «Stop Processing Rules» (Остановить обработку правил), либо «Delete Message» (Удалить сообщение).

Эти действия MDaemon может выполнять, если сообщение соответствует условиям правила. Для некоторых действий нужна дополнительная информация, которую вы зададите, щелкнув на гиперссылке соответствующего Действия в поле «Описание правила».

Delete Message — (Удалить сообщение) Выбор этого действия приведет к удалению сообщения.

Strip All Attachments From Message — (Вырезать все вложения) Это действие приведет к вырезанию всех вложений из сообщения.

Skip n Rules — (Пропустить n правил) Выбор этого действия приведет к пропуску определенного количества правил. Это полезно в ситуации, когда вы хотите, чтобы правило было применено в определенной ситуации, кроме всех остальных ситуаций.

Например: вы можете захотеть удалять сообщения, которые содержат слово «Spam», но не те, которые содержат «Good Spam». Для этого вы можете создать правило, которое удаляет сообщения, содержащие «Spam», а затем поместить над ним другое правило, которое указывает, что «если сообщение содержит «Good Spam», то пропустить 1 правило».

Stop Processing Rules — (Остановить обработку правил) Это действие приведет к пропуску всех оставшихся правил.

Copy Message To Specified User(s) — (Отправить копии на эти адреса) Приводит к отправке копии сообщения одному или нескольким получателям. Вы должны задать получателей для копий этого сообщения.

Append a corporate signature — (Добавить подпись) Это действие позволяет вставлять в конце каждого письма заданный вами небольшой текст. В другом варианте вы можете добавлять содержание из текстового файла. Также доступна флаговая кнопка » Использовать HTML» на случай, если вы захотите добавить код HTML в текст подписи.

Например: вы можете использовать это правило для включения заявления, которое гласит: «Это письмо отправлено от моей компании; любые жалобы или вопросы направляйте по адресу user01@example.com».

Add Extra Header Item To Message — (Добавить заголовок) Это действие будет добавлять к сообщению дополнительный заголовок. Следует указать название и содержание (значение) нового заголовка.

Delete A Header Item From Message — (Удалить заголовок) Это действие удалит заголовок из сообщения. Следует явно указать заголовок, который нужно удалить.

Send a Note To. — (Отправить уведомление…) Это действие отправит письма по указанным вами адресам. Вы сможете задать получателя, отправителя, тему и небольшой текст. Кроме того, вы можете настроить это действие так, чтобы к уведомлению присоединялось исходное обрабатываемое сообщение. Примечание: Это действие пропускает все сообщения, у которых отсутствует значение «return-path». Таким образом, событие не может быть вызвано, к примеру, уведомлением о статусе доставки (Delivery Status Notification).

Например: вам может пригодиться правило, которое будет перемещать все сообщения, содержащие текст «Это спам!» в каталог плохих сообщений, а также еще одно правило, которое будет отправлять кому-нибудь письмо, извещающее о об обнаружении и перемещении такой почты.

Читайте также:  Радар детектор томагавк навахо точная настройка видео

Remove Digital Signature — (Удалить цифровую подпись) Выберите это действие для удаления цифровой подписи из сообщения.

Send Message through SMS Gateway Server… — (Отправить на мобильный телефон) выберите эту опцию для отправки сообщения через Сервер SMS-шлюза (SMS Gateway Server). Для отправки SMS-сообщения следует указать имя или IP-адрес хоста, а также номер телефона.

Copy Message to Folder… — (Копировать сообщение в папку…) Используйте эту опцию, чтобы поместить копию сообщения в указанную папку.

MOVE the messages to custom QUEUE… — (Переместить в очередь) Это действие перемещает сообщение в одну или несколько предварительно созданных дополнительных почтовых очередей. При перемещении сообщений в удаленные дополнительные почтовые очереди вы можете использовать дополнительные параметры расписаний в Планировщике событий, чтобы явно указать, когда следует обрабатывать такие сообщения.

Add Line To Text File — (Добавить строку к текстовому файлу) Это действие добавляет строку текста к указанному текстовому файлу. При выборе этого действия вы должны указать путь к файлу и текст, который хотите к нему присоединить. Вы можете использовать в своем тексте отдельные макросы MDaemon, чтобы фильтр содержания динамически включал в текст такие сведения о сообщении, как отправитель, получатель, ID сообщения и др. Нажмите кнопку «Макрос» в диалоге «Добавить строку к текстовому файлу», чтобы вывести список допустимых макросов.

[Copy|Move] Message to Public Folders. — (Копировать/переместить в общие папки) Используйте это действие, чтобы переместить сообщение в одну или несколько Публичных папок общего пользования.

Search and Replace Words in a Header — (Заголовок – поиск и замена) Это действие проверяет наличие в заголовке указанных вами слов, а затем удаляет или заменяет их. При создании такого правила щелкните на ссылке «specify information» (указать сведения) в поле описания правила, чтобы открыть диалог «Заголовок – поиск и замена», где вы укажете нужный заголовок и слова, которые нужно заменить или удалить. В этом действии теперь поддерживаются регулярные выражения. См. также:Использование регулярных выражений в правилах фильтрации.

Search and Replace Words in the Message Body — (Тело – поиск и замена) Используйте это действие для поиска и замены заданного текста в теле сообщения. В этом действии теперь поддерживаются регулярные выражения. См. также:Использование регулярных выражений в правилах фильтрации.

Jump to Rule. — (Перейти к правилу) Используйте это действие для немедленного перехода к правилу, расположенному ниже по списку, пропуская все правила между этими двумя.

Add to Windows Event Log. — Используйте это действие, чтобы записать текстовую строку в журнал событий Windows. Вы можете использовать в строке макросы. При этом имеется кнопка для отображения разрешенных макросов.

Extract attachments to folder. — Используйте это действие, чтобы извлечь из сообщения вложения. Укажите папку, в которую будут копироваться вложения, и удаляйте вложение из сообщения после извлечения. Вы также можете задать условия, которые будут определять, какие вложения будут извлекаться (в зависимости от имени файла, типа содержимого и размера вложения).

Extract attachments to folder. — Используйте это действие, чтобы извлечь из сообщения вложения. Укажите папку, в которую будут копироваться вложения, и удаляйте вложение из сообщения после извлечения. Вы также можете задать условия, которые будут определять, какие вложения будут извлекаться (в зависимости от имени файла, типа содержимого и размера вложения).

Sign with DomainKeys selector. — (DKIM Подпись) Используйте это действие, если вы хотите, чтобы правило вставило в сообщениеподпись DKIM. Это же действие можно использовать, если вы хотите подписать некоторые сообщения с использованием селектора, отличного от того, который назначен в диалоге «DKIM».

Flag message for REQUIRETLS. — Показывает, что сообщение должно использовать REQUIRETLS.

[Sign|Encrypt|Decrypt] message with the user’s [Private|Public] key. — Используйте эти действия для подписи, шифрования или дешифрования сообщения с использованием личного или открытого ключа. См. также:MDPGP для получения дополнительной информации. Примечание: Эти действия будут выполняться, даже если MDPGP отключен.

Add a warning to the top of the message. — Используйте это действие, если хотите добавить в начало сообщения какое-либо предупреждение. Вы просто вводите строку простого текста или HTML-код и устанавливаете флажок «Использовать HTML». Кроме того, вы можете загрузить текст из файла.

Это поле показывает создаваемое правило во внутреннем скриптовом формате. Щелкните на любом из условий или действий правила (показанных в виде гиперссылок), тогда откроется соответствующий редактор для указания всей необходимой информации.

Источник